About John K. Warren
John K. Warren is a scholar working on Earth-Surface Processes, Geochemistry and Petrology, Geology, Paleontology and Geophysics, having authored 56 papers that have together received 5.0k indexed citations. Recurring topics across this work include Geological formations and processes (21 papers), Paleontology and Stratigraphy of Fossils (16 papers), Hydrocarbon exploration and reservoir analysis (16 papers), Geology and Paleoclimatology Research (13 papers), Geological and Geophysical Studies (13 papers), Groundwater and Isotope Geochemistry (12 papers), Geological and Geochemical Analysis (9 papers) and earthquake and tectonic studies (8 papers). The work is most often cited by research in Paleontology (2.1k citations), Earth-Surface Processes (1.4k citations), Geochemistry and Petrology (982 citations), Geophysics (1.9k citations) and Geology (688 citations). John K. Warren has collaborated with scholars based in Thailand, United States and Australia. Frequent co-authors include C.K. Morley, Christopher Kendall, Michael R. Rosen, Donald E. Miser, Joseph J. Lambiase, M.J.R. Gee, Mahbub Hussain, B. Schreiber, Mohamed El Tabakh and Hossein Kazemi. Their work appears in journals such as Sedimentology, Journal of Sedimentary Research, Earth-Science Reviews, Marine and Petroleum Geology and Sedimentary Geology.
